<title>perf symbols: Fix slowness due to -ffunction-section</title>

Perf can take minutes to parse an image when -ffunction-section is used.
This is especially true with the kernel image when it is compiled this
way, which is the arm64 default since the patcheset "Enable deadcode
elimination at link time".

Perf organize maps using a rbtree. Whenever perf finds a new symbols, it
first searches this rbtree for the map it belongs to, by strcmp()'aring
section names.  When it finds the map with the right name, it uses it to
add the symbol. With a usual image there aren't so many maps but when
using -ffunction-section there's basically one map per function.  With
the kernel image that's north of 40,000 maps. For most symbols perf has
to parses the entire rbtree to eventually create a new map and add it.
Consequently perf spends most of the time browsing a rbtree that keeps
getting larger.

This performance fix introduces a secondary rbtree that indexes maps
based on the section name.

<title>perf tools: Fix maps__find_symbol_by_name()</title>

Commit 1c5aae7710bb ("perf machine: Create maps for x86 PTI entry
trampolines") revealed a problem with maps__find_symbol_by_name() that
resulted in probes not being found e.g.

	$ sudo perf probe xsk_mmap
	xsk_mmap is out of .text, skip it.
	Probe point 'xsk_mmap' not found.
	   Error: Failed to add events.

maps__find_symbol_by_name() can optionally return the map of the found
symbol. It can get the map wrong because, in fact, the symbol is found
on the map's dso, not allowing for the possibility that the dso has more
than one map. Fix by always checking the map contains the symbol.
